Zymolyase, Arthrobacter luteus
Zymolyase (Arthrobacter luteus) is a lytic enzyme primarily found in the bacterium Arthrobacter luteus. This enzyme possesses β-1,3-glucanase activity, enabling it to remove the electron-dense outer layer of Plasmodium falciparum cell walls, thereby exposing the electron-transparent layer.
